Anyone know of a good chess program?

I am looking for a program that has a coach function of warning a player if he makes a bad move and without telling the player the better move and if possible also the option of "find a better move" in analysis like lichess has.

I worked with SCID (http://scid.sourceforge.net/) which does have a "coach" function which warns you when one of your moves gives away x centipawns. You play against any engine (of course you will only use this for play with an engine, right), and another engine is the coach and watches your moves.
Theres more functionality like guessing the moves of master games with the coach watching, but i am not sure if you can emulate that lichess function you were talking about.

The coach function is very buggy in my SCID installation, not sure if this will be a problem for you, could be due to my computer setup or something else.
I recommend using Fritz which has a coach function that warns the player if he is going astray. You can also use Fritz to tell you the positional evaluation (in centipawns) of all legal moves in the current position. The Fritz GUI also has a hint function which will give you the current best move that it is thinking about.

I recommend buying Fritz for the GUI, but you should replace the Fritz engine with Stockfish 8 because according to the CCRL (Computer Chess Ratings List) at http://www.computerchess.org.uk/ccrl/404/ and the TCEC (Top Chess Engine Competition) web site at http://tcec.chessdom.com/live.php Stockfish 8 is now the world's strongest chess playing program.

Haven't done this in a while. I believe there are two ways to do it. I just clicked through it once.
1) Play -> Serious Game, a dialog shows up where you set "coach is watching" to yes.
2) Play -> Tactical Game should do the same, but i'm not sure
The other options you find at Play -> Training. But i recommend searching the help files, it should be documented there.
If you haven't done this yet: You need to install the chess engines seperatly and tell SCID about them. I have stockfish and togaII, both are free. Again, hit the manuals if youre not sure how to set everyting up.
